Turning Ideas into Apps: The Role of User Experience in App Development
Introduction
In today's saturated mobile app market, having a great idea is just the first step toward success. To truly stand out, one must prioritize user experience (UX) throughout the app development process. This article explores how UX shapes the transformation of an idea into a fully-fledged mobile application.
The problem lies in that many developers focus solely on functionality, disregarding UX design. However, users demand more than just a working app—they seek intuitive interfaces, seamless navigation, and overall enjoyable experiences. As such, integrating UX principles into your Idea-to-App process is not merely an option; it's a necessity for creating user-centric apps.
This article will provide insights on how to embed UX design throughout your app development, using real-world examples and case studies. We will also offer detailed explanations and actionable advice to help you create engaging, user-friendly apps from your unique ideas.
The Importance of User Experience in App Development
User Experience is no longer a luxury but a fundamental requirement in modern app development. For instance, consider Uber's success—it's not just about their unique business model but also their emphasis on creating an intuitive and hassle-free booking experience. They've crafted an app that satisfies user needs efficiently and pleasantly—a testament to effective UX design.
A study by Forrester Research found that well-designed User Interface (UI) could yield up to a 200% increase in conversion rates. Thus, neglecting UX design could lead to lower user engagement, poor reviews, and ultimately, app failure.
Practical Tips for Integrating UX into Your App Development Process
Implementing UX principles into your Idea-to-App process might seem daunting, but with the right approach, it becomes manageable. Here are some practical tips:
-
Understand Your Users: Conduct thorough research to understand your users' needs and preferences. Develop personas and map out user journeys to design an app that truly resonates with your audience.
-
Prototype and Test: Create prototypes of your app and conduct usability tests to gather feedback. This allows you to rectify any UX issues before launching.
-
Iterate and Improve: Based on the feedback, make necessary adjustments to your app's UX design. Remember, UX is not a one-time task but a continuous process of improvement.
Actionable Advice for Creating User-Centric Apps
When creating user-centric apps, it is essential to prioritize functionality in harmony with aesthetics.
Focus on Simplicity: Avoid unnecessary complexity in your app's UI design. A simple, clean interface is often more effective than a cluttered one filled with seldom-used features.
Ensure Consistency: Maintain consistency across all screens in terms of fonts, color schemes, button styles, etc., to provide a seamless user experience.
Consider Accessibility: Design your app keeping in mind the diverse range of users. Make sure it is accessible to people with various abilities by following accessibility guidelines for mobile apps.
Conclusion
In conclusion, the role of User Experience in turning ideas into successful apps cannot be overemphasized. An intuitive UI/UX design is crucial for ensuring user satisfaction, which translates into higher engagement rates and successful apps.
As you embark on your Idea-to-App journey, remember to prioritize your users' needs and expectations. Implement the practical tips and actionable advice discussed above to create a user-centric app that stands out in the competitive app market.
Embrace the power of User Experience in your app development process—it's not just about making apps, but about creating experiences.